Output dd4331478a4039792ba3b94ea80f05fd1b625aaf9752b4c66a16b7be1d558c53:1

value
1005185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b394397280b0f9dab4f8801ce8292393f4bb1cb OP_EQUAL
address
3QbN8U4dfCxwtXAcgWTkqwGtP1PcaZ2sgv
transaction
dd4331478a4039792ba3b94ea80f05fd1b625aaf9752b4c66a16b7be1d558c53
confirmations
438271
spent
true

2 Sat Ranges